3. The Role of Piggyback Forklifts in Enhancing Efficiency
3.1 What are Piggyback Forklifts?
Piggyback forklifts are specialized forklifts that can transport goods and pallets on the back of a truck. They combine the functionalities of a traditional forklift with the mobility of a truck, making them ideal for transportation within a distribution center.
3.2 Key Features of Piggyback Forklifts
These forklifts come equipped with features such as:
- **High maneuverability** allowing for operation in tight spaces.
- **Robust lifting capabilities** designed to handle heavy loads.
- **Integrated design** that enables easy loading and unloading directly onto trailers.
4. Advantages of Using Piggyback Forklifts in Distribution Centers
Utilizing piggyback forklifts in distribution centers offers numerous benefits that can enhance overall productivity.
4.1 Space Optimization
By enabling the loading and unloading of goods directly from trucks, piggyback forklifts reduce the need for additional storage space. This optimization allows for better use of the facility, freeing up valuable square footage for other operations.
4.2 Cost Effectiveness
The use of piggyback forklifts can lead to substantial cost savings. Fewer labor hours are required for loading and unloading, and the efficient handling of goods reduces the likelihood of damage, further minimizing operational costs.
4.3 Versatility in Handling Different Loads
Piggyback forklifts can easily adapt to a variety of load types, including pallets and bulk items, making them suitable for diverse distribution center operations. Their versatility ensures that facilities can manage different products without needing specialized equipment.

8. Frequently Asked Questions
8.1 What distinguishes piggyback forklifts from traditional forklifts?
Piggyback forklifts can transport loads on the back of a truck, combining the functionalities of both a forklift and a vehicle, unlike traditional forklifts which are limited to warehouse operations.
8.2 Are piggyback forklifts suitable for outdoor use?
Yes, many piggyback forklifts are designed for outdoor use, making them versatile for different work environments.
8.3 How do I maintain a piggyback forklift?
Regular inspections, adherence to manufacturer guidelines, and timely repairs are essential for maintaining a piggyback forklift.
8.4 How can I train my staff on piggyback forklifts?
Training can be provided through in-house programs or by hiring certified trainers who specialize in forklift operation.
8.5 What costs are associated with implementing piggyback forklifts?
Costs include the purchase or lease of the forklifts, training expenses, and ongoing maintenance. However, the long-term savings can offset these initial investments.
